Newton's Off-Center Circular Orbits and the Magnetic Monopole
Published 27 Jul 2023 in math-ph and math.MP | (2307.15222v2)
Abstract: Introducing a radially dependent magnetic field into Newton's off-center circular orbits potential so as to preserve the dynamical symmetry leads to a unique choice of field that can be identified as the inclusion of a magnetic monopole in the inverse stereographically projected problem. One finds also a phenomenological correspondence with that of the linearly damped Kepler model. The presence of the monopole field deforms the symmetry algebra by a central extension, and the quantum mechanical version of this algebra reveals a number of zero modes equal to that counted using the index theorem of elliptic operators.
